Damien Bendall, 33, was handed a whole-life sentence for the murders of 35-year-old Terri Harris, her 11-year-old daughter Lacey Bennett, her son John Paul Bennett, 13, and Lacey's friend Connie Gent, 11, after attacking them with a claw hammer at a property in Killamarsh, Derbyshire. He also admitted to raping Lacey as she lay dying.
It emerged that the killer had a string of convictions and a history of violence prior to the murders in September 2021, leading Dominic Raab, the justice secretary, to open a review into the Probation Service's handling of Bendall, a repeat offender who had been under its supervision since 2011.
Chief inspector of probation Justin Russell said the Probation Service's work with Bendall was of an "unacceptable standard" at every stage - including approving him to be curfewed in Harris's home months before he killed her and the children.
